Subject: Quickstore 4.2 — bloom filter now fronts the KV layer

Plugin authors: starting with this release, Quickstore places a bloom filter ahead of the key-value store. Negative lookups return faster; false positives fall through safely. No API changes are required on your side. Verify your plugin against the staging build referenced below.

session token of fahif-tadup = htk3_9c7

TURN-208: Gatevale turnstile counters at the Merrow Field pilot double-count when a rotation reverses mid-cycle. Attendance totals drift roughly 2% high per event. The debounce window fix is implemented, reviewed by Ilsa, and soak-tested across two simulated match days without drift. Ready for your cut; the candidate build is identified below.

trace token, tagag-tafog: htk6_5ed18c

Subject: DR drill Thursday — bounce processor failover

Team,

Thursday we fail the Quillhaven bounce processor over to the standby region. Reviewers: approve the failover PR by Wednesday noon. During the drill, the standby node's suppression-list store comes up sealed by design; whoever runs the cutover unseals it manually and confirms bounce classification resumes within five minutes. Document timings in the drill log. No customer mail is affected; everything replays from the relay buffer. The unseal step takes the recovery passphrase below.

vault phrase of tawig-taduf = zorath-oliwyn